网络
代码artist
互联网+人工智能
嵌入式,android,python,spring,tensorFolw
展开
-
网络--socket
Socket代码示例,以下两个程序,分别实现了TCP 和UDP,从客户端发送一条字符串给服务端,服务端收到这个信息后,打印出来,并返回字符串的长度给客户端。// TCP 每个 class 都是一个单独的 .java 文件public class LengthCalculator extends Thread { //以socket为成员变量 private...原创 2018-11-25 16:27:38 · 434 阅读 · 0 评论 -
telnet命令--学习
telnet命令----用来网络调试。PC主机IP地址,192.168.0.107。虚拟机ubuntu的ip地址:192.168.0.107,在ubuntu中telnet主机:telnet 192.168.0.107 8189PC端开启Socket Server程序,用java编写,代码如下:public class EchoServer{ public static v...原创 2018-12-02 17:55:35 · 474 阅读 · 0 评论 -
计算机网络知识点
网络协议分两个标准,一个是OSI标准(国家标准化组织定的标准),一个是TCP/IP标准(实际网络中的协议)。 TCP/IP 对应 OSI TCP/IP OSI 应用层 应用层 表示层 会话层 主机到主机层(TCP)(又称传输层) 传输层 ...原创 2018-12-01 23:55:14 · 257 阅读 · 0 评论 -
网络--IP
IP定义IP提供不可靠、无连接的数据报传送服务:(1)不可靠(unreliable)的意思是它不能保证IP数据报能成功地到达目的地。 IP仅提供最好的传输服务。如果发生某种错误时,如某个路由器暂时用完了缓冲区, IP有一个简单的错误处理算法:丢弃该数据报,然后发送 ICMP消息报给信源端。任何要求的可靠性必须由上层来提供(如TCP)。(2)无连接(connectionless)这个术语...原创 2019-04-26 01:40:58 · 458 阅读 · 0 评论 -
网络--TCP
本文中主要参考《TCP/IP详解卷1》TCP1.1定义尽管 TCP 和 UDP 都使用相同的网络层(IP), TCP 却向应用层提供与 UDP 完全不同的服务。TCP 提供一种面向连接的、可靠的字节流服务。面向连接意味着两个使用 T C P的应用(通常是一个客户和一个服务器)在彼此交换数据之前必须先建立一个 T C P连接。这一过程与打电话很相似,先拨号振铃,等待对方摘机说“喂”,...原创 2019-04-26 10:17:09 · 195 阅读 · 0 评论 -
网络--UDP
UDP定义U D P是一个简单的面向数据报的运输层协议:进程的每个输出操作都正好产生一个 U D P数据报,并组装成一份待发送的 I P数据报。这与面向流字符的协议不同,如 T C P,应用程序产生的全体数据与真正发送的单个 I P数据报可能没有什么联系。U D P不提供可靠性:它把应用程序传给 I P层的数据发送出去,但是并不保证它们能到达目的地。由于缺乏可靠性,我们似乎觉得要避免...原创 2019-04-26 11:08:20 · 1089 阅读 · 0 评论 -
网络--HTTP/HTTPS
HTTPHTTPS实际操作参考文章:Http协议报文格式,包括请求头信息,响应吗列表,相应头信息对于HTTPS协议,参考:[网络]从wireshark抓包看百度的https流程Http报文格式(这两个图非常的好)GET用swagger获取,再用Wireshark转包,...原创 2019-04-26 12:18:41 · 903 阅读 · 0 评论